Lawsuit Filed Against Gun Shop Over Sale of AR-15 Used in Bank Shooting

Survivors and families of victims of the April mass shooting at Old National Bank have filed a lawsuit against Louisville gun shop River City Firearms, alleging that the store overlooked red flags when selling the AR-15-style rifle used in the shooting. The plaintiffs are seeking compensatory and punitive damages, claiming that the gun seller's negligence contributed to the tragedy. The lawsuit also highlights the need for accountability and stricter measures in firearm sales to prevent similar incidents in the future.

Unraveling the Louisville Shooting: Gunman's Identity, Updates, and Police Response.

Connor Sturgeon, a former bank worker and University of Alabama graduate, stormed the Old National Bank in downtown Louisville, Kentucky, where he worked armed with an AR-15-style rifle, and gunned down five of his colleagues in the first-floor conference room. Sturgeon had worked at the bank as a syndications associate and portfolio banker and had been recently notified that he was going to be fired. The motive for the attack remains unclear but the gunman is said to have left behind ominous warnings about his deadly plans for his family and friends to find. The five victims killed in Monday’s attack have been identified as Josh Barrick, Tommy Elliott, Jim Tutt, Juliana Farmer, and Deanna Eckert.

Louisville Mass Shooting: Updates and Victim Identified.

Juliana Farmer, one of the five victims of the mass shooting at a bank in Louisville, had just moved to the city two weeks prior for a new job as a loan officer with Old National Bank. Farmer had three adult children and four grandsons. The shooter, Connor Sturgeon, opened fire with an AR15-style rifle and killed five colleagues while livestreaming the bloodshed before he was fatally shot by a responding officer. The Louisville community gathered for a vigil to mourn the victims and seek comfort in each other.

Louisville Bank Shooting Leaves 5 Dead, 8 Injured, Including Rookie Officer.

A 25-year-old bank employee, Connor Sturgeon, opened fire at his workplace in downtown Louisville, Kentucky, killing five and injuring eight others. Sturgeon livestreamed the attack on Instagram and was killed by police after a shootout. The gun used was an AR-15-style rifle, and Sturgeon had been notified he was going to be terminated from his job. The shooting is the latest in a string of mass shootings in the US, with at least 145 occurring this year. President Biden called on Republicans in Congress to take action on gun laws.
